网络流量检测在物联网中的挑战

随着物联网(IoT)技术的飞速发展,网络流量检测在物联网中的应用越来越广泛。然而,在物联网环境下,网络流量检测面临着诸多挑战。本文将深入探讨网络流量检测在物联网中的挑战,并分析相应的解决方案。

一、物联网环境下网络流量检测的挑战

  1. 海量数据:物联网设备数量庞大,产生的数据量呈指数级增长。如何高效、准确地检测海量数据,成为网络流量检测的一大挑战。

  2. 异构网络:物联网设备种类繁多,包括传感器、摄像头、智能家电等,这些设备使用的网络协议和传输方式各异。如何实现跨协议、跨设备的网络流量检测,成为一大难题。

  3. 实时性要求:物联网应用对实时性要求较高,如智能家居、智能交通等。如何在保证实时性的前提下,进行网络流量检测,是物联网网络流量检测的又一挑战。

  4. 安全性问题:物联网设备的安全性一直是业界关注的焦点。网络流量检测过程中,如何确保数据传输的安全性,防止数据泄露和恶意攻击,是物联网网络流量检测的关键问题。

  5. 能耗问题:物联网设备通常采用电池供电,能耗问题成为制约其发展的瓶颈。如何在保证网络流量检测准确性的同时,降低能耗,是物联网网络流量检测的挑战之一。

二、应对物联网网络流量检测挑战的解决方案

  1. 数据采集与处理:采用分布式数据采集技术,将海量数据分散到多个节点进行处理,提高数据处理效率。同时,运用大数据技术,对数据进行深度挖掘和分析,为网络流量检测提供有力支持。

  2. 跨协议检测:针对物联网设备种类繁多、协议复杂的问题,研发通用检测引擎,实现跨协议、跨设备的网络流量检测。

  3. 实时性优化:采用边缘计算技术,将数据处理任务下沉到网络边缘,降低数据传输延迟,提高实时性。同时,采用流处理技术,对实时数据进行分析,实现实时网络流量检测。

  4. 安全性保障:采用加密技术,对数据传输进行加密,确保数据传输的安全性。此外,引入安全协议,如TLS/SSL,提高网络流量检测的安全性。

  5. 能耗优化:采用节能技术,如动态调整检测频率、优化算法等,降低能耗。同时,研究新型电池技术,提高电池续航能力。

三、案例分析

以智能家居为例,智能家居设备众多,包括智能电视、智能空调、智能灯泡等。这些设备产生的网络流量数据量巨大,且实时性要求较高。为了实现网络流量检测,可以采用以下方案:

  1. 分布式数据采集:将智能家居设备产生的数据分散到多个节点进行处理,提高数据处理效率。

  2. 跨协议检测:采用通用检测引擎,实现跨协议、跨设备的网络流量检测。

  3. 实时性优化:采用边缘计算技术,将数据处理任务下沉到网络边缘,降低数据传输延迟。

  4. 安全性保障:采用加密技术,对数据传输进行加密,确保数据传输的安全性。

  5. 能耗优化:采用节能技术,降低能耗。

通过以上方案,可以有效实现智能家居网络流量检测,为用户提供更加安全、便捷的智能家居体验。

总之,网络流量检测在物联网中面临着诸多挑战。通过采用分布式数据采集、跨协议检测、实时性优化、安全性保障和能耗优化等解决方案,可以有效应对这些挑战,推动物联网技术的进一步发展。

猜你喜欢:云网分析